The Nightster Special [2024] starts at ₹ 14.09 Lakh, while the Ninja 1100SX is priced at ₹ 14.42 Lakh (ex-showroom). You can easily compare all the required parameters for your new two-wheeler. These two-wheelers have powerful motors with good performance. Among them, the Nightster Special [2024] offers 95 Nm @ 5750 torque. The Ninja 1100SX gives 113 Nm @ 7600 rpm torque.
